Roberts lead Cardinal men to second place at Lilac Invitational

| October 10, 2018 1:00 AM

LIBERTY LAKE — Nick Roberts finished tied for first for North Idaho College, firing a two-day total of 140 to lead the Cardinals to a runner-up finish in the inaugural Lilac Invitational at Liberty Lake Golf Course on Tuesday.

Reece Nilsen of Rocky Mountain earned men’s medalist in a three-way playoff.

Rocky Mountain won the men’s and women’s team titles.

MEN

at Liberty Lake Golf Course

Par 70

6,607 yards

TEAM SCORES — 1, Rocky Mountain 283-292—575. 2, North Idaho 278-303—581. 3, Spokane 287-301—588. 4, Whitworth 290-299—589. 5, Lewis-Clark State 289-304—593. 6, Whitworth “B” 293-302—595. 7, Skagit Valley 305-313—618. 8, Rocky Mountain “B” 311-311—622. 9, Columbia Basin 335-318—653. 10, Olympic 331-334—665.

MEDALIST — Reece Nilsen, Rocky Mountain, 71-69—140.

NORTH IDAHO — Nick Roberts 69-71—140, Tyler Jones 72-71—143, Austin Mitchell 74-71—145, Bo Knittel 70-76—146, Lincoln Hirrlinger 72-74—146, Jesse Henderson 70-77—147, Braxton Stewart 69-79—148, Bryce Mocabee 70-79—149, Dawson Strobel 71-84—155.

WOMEN

at MeadowWood Golf Course,

Liberty Lake

Par 72

5,880 yards

TEAM SCORES — 1, Rocky Mountain 303-301—604. 2, Lewis-Clark State 312-319—631. 3, Whitworth 319-326—645. 4, Columbia Basin 337-333—670. 5 (tie), North Idaho 361-357—718, Skagit Valley 363-355—718. 7, Spokane 359-376—735.

MEDALIST — Hayden Flohr, Rocky Mountain, 74-72—146.

NORTH IDAHO — Mackenzie Robins 87-85—172, Caitlyn Fisher 85-88—173, Jessey Simmons 92-92—184, Madeline Neff 97-92—189, Kaylie Hayes 99-95—194.
